The Medical Surgical Case Manager in the Emergency Department, as a member of a multidisciplinary team, collaborates with physicians, nurses, and medical directors to coordinate, facilitate, and expedite patient care services across the continuum from pre-admission to discharge and continuing care. As a member of that team, you would be responsible for the implementation of the discharge plan and ensuring efficient and effective delivery of patient care services through appropriate utilization of healthcare resources.
